> Anyone know if there is a default minimum username length for some (or
> all) current Linux distros?

One character. My employer allows people to choose their
username and a lot of people use initials (of 2-5 letters).

If you are setting up a new policy, I'd suggest something
not based on name at all. Mainly because one of the few
constitutional rights we have is the ability to change
our name after marriage, and sysadmins that refuse to
change the associated username find themselves on the
losing side.

But of course, technically changing the username is a real pain,
so better not to place yourself there at all.
